**Mgmt Meeting Minutes — Retiring the Brightline Range**

Quick recap for sales leads at Fenholt Supplies: we agreed to retire the Brightline fixture range by year-end. Remaining stock moves to clearance pricing next month, and accounts on standing orders get migrated to the Lumetta range. Trade-in incentives were approved in principle. The confidential note on next steps sits just below.

board note of bajof-bajeg: The pricing group signed off on a budget of $13.4 million for Project Sildor. The renewal with Lamixek Holdings closes at $48.9 million a year, 49 percent above the last contract.

Handover note — Garrowfield occupancy feed

Welcome aboard. The parking-garage occupancy feed polls the Garrowfield sensor hub every 30 seconds and publishes counts per level to the city dashboard. Known quirks: level B2 sensors double-count motorcycles, and the nightly recalibration job must finish before 05:00 or the morning numbers drift. Deploys go through the usual pipeline; nothing exotic. If the feed's credential store ever locks you out, recovery requires the escrow passphrase, which I'm leaving for you directly below.

recovery phrase for bawep-kawef: oliath-casdor

## Runbook: Gaugepile Sidecar — Release Checklist

Heads up: the sidecar ships with every app pod, so a bad config fans out fast. Before cutting a release, confirm the flush interval hasn't drifted from what the Tallyhouse aggregator expects, or you'll see sawtooth gaps in dashboards. Rollbacks are cheap — just repin the image tag. Canary one node pool first, watch for ten minutes, then proceed. The values to verify against are these.

config for bagep-yafof:
quenath:
  pin: 8584
  metrics_host: metrics.quenath.tolvaqsys.internal
  tenant: pelath
  seal: seal_ed102645